Kabco Introduce New ‘Luxury’ Welfare Unit
In response to the demand for premium, high specification welfare facilities, Kabco has developed a composite paneled unit that benefits from a self supporting structure, aesthetically pleasing stainless steel surfaces and industry standard windows and doors. “This product is at the ‘luxury’ end of the welfare market.” Reports Daniel Ezzatrar Kabco’s company manager.
The ‘top of the range’ Kabco Composite panels contain insulation material, which is sandwiched between GRP (interior) and steel (exterior). This lends itself to improved thermal dynamics throughout, making the unit more energy efficient.
Other features include, patented air suspension ensuring soft ride when towing. The transport industry recognises air suspension as the method of choice in reducing fatigue to both chassis and cargo.
Additional environmentally friendly extras include plug in solar panels that can be added on to the 12v battery system and an optional rainwater harvesting system for toilet flushing.
At the other end of the scale, Kabco recently launched the Kabco Cub, the prototype was on display at SED 09. Since its launch the unit has been selling like hot cakes! “The Cub unit is the most competitively priced unit on the market and was built in response to the downturn in the market,” said Mr Ezzatrar.
“The Cub benefits from ground lowering air suspension and industry standard appliances and parts, ensuring that the savings that the unit has to offer do not stop at the purchase price. We now have a rolling stock of units in build to satisfy short notice customer demand.” Mr Ezzatrar concluded.
